    Dental Care Tips for Children – A Parent’s Complete Guide

    Good oral health habits should start early in life. Children’s dental care plays a crucial role in preventing cavities, maintaining healthy gums, and ensuring proper development of permanent teeth. Parents can make a big difference by guiding children toward good oral hygiene practices.

    When Should a Child First Visit the Dentist?

    Children should visit a dentist when their first tooth appears or by their first birthday. Early visits help detect potential problems and make children comfortable with dental check-ups.

    Caring for Milk Teeth

    Milk teeth may be temporary, but they are important for chewing, speech, and guiding permanent teeth into place. Ignoring milk teeth can lead to pain and infections.

    Tips for caring for milk teeth:

    • Clean gums with a soft cloth before teeth appear
    • Use a soft-bristled toothbrush once teeth erupt
    • Supervise brushing until the child can do it properly

    Teaching Proper Brushing Habits

    Children should brush twice a day using a pea-sized amount of fluoride toothpaste. Parents should assist young children to ensure all teeth are cleaned properly.

    Making brushing fun with songs or routines helps children develop consistent habits.

    Diet Tips for Healthy Teeth

    A child’s diet plays an important role in dental health. Sugary snacks and drinks increase the risk of cavities.

    Healthy habits include:

    • Encouraging fruits and vegetables
    • Limiting sweets and sugary drinks
    • Promoting water over sweetened beverages

    Preventing Dental Fear in Children

    Positive dental experiences help reduce fear and anxiety. Avoid using scary words and encourage children with reassurance.

    Regular visits to a dental clinic near you help children become familiar with the dental environment and build lifelong confidence.

    Importance of Regular Dental Check-Ups

    Routine dental visits help monitor growth, identify early problems, and guide preventive care. Healthy dental habits in childhood lead to healthier smiles in adulthood.

    Common Dental Problems and How to Prevent Them

    Dental problems are more common than many people realize. Ignoring early symptoms can lead to pain, infections, and expensive treatments. The good news is that most dental issues can be prevented with proper care and regular check-ups.

    Here are some of the most common dental problems and how you can avoid them.

    1. Tooth Decay and Cavities

    Tooth decay occurs when plaque builds up on teeth and produces acids that damage enamel. Cavities can cause pain and sensitivity if left untreated.

    Prevention tips:

    • Brush twice daily with fluoride toothpaste
    • Avoid excessive sugary foods and drinks
    • Visit a dentist regularly

    2. Gum Disease

    Gum disease starts with swollen or bleeding gums and can progress to serious infections if ignored. It is a leading cause of tooth loss in adults.

    Prevention tips:

    • Floss daily to remove plaque between teeth
    • Maintain good oral hygiene
    • Get professional teeth cleaning when advised

    3. Tooth Sensitivity

    Sensitive teeth cause discomfort when consuming hot, cold, or sweet foods. This often happens due to worn enamel or exposed tooth roots.

    Prevention tips:

    • Use toothpaste designed for sensitive teeth
    • Avoid aggressive brushing
    • Consult a dentist if sensitivity persists

    4. Bad Breath

    Persistent bad breath can be caused by poor oral hygiene, gum disease, dry mouth, or dental infections.

    Prevention tips:

    • Brush your tongue daily
    • Stay hydrated
    • Treat underlying dental issues promptly

    5. Tooth Loss

    Tooth loss can result from untreated decay, gum disease, or injury. Missing teeth affect chewing, speech, and confidence.

    Prevention tips:

    • Address dental problems early
    • Wear mouthguards during sports
    • Follow a dentist’s care recommendations

    Dental Implants – Everything You Need to Know Before Choosing One

    Missing teeth can affect your smile, confidence, and ability to chew properly. Dental implants are one of the most advanced and long-lasting solutions for replacing missing teeth. Understanding how implants work can help you decide if they are the right option for you.

    What Are Dental Implants?

    Dental implants are artificial tooth roots, usually made of titanium, that are placed into the jawbone. Once healed, a crown is fixed on top, making the implant look and function like a natural tooth.

    They are designed to provide a strong and permanent foundation for replacement teeth.

    Who Is Eligible for Dental Implants?

    Most adults with good oral and general health are suitable candidates for dental implants. You may be eligible if:

    • You have one or more missing teeth
    • Your jawbone is healthy enough to support an implant
    • You maintain good oral hygiene
    • You do not have untreated gum disease

    A dentist will evaluate your condition before recommending implants.

    Dental Implant Procedure Overview

    The dental implant process usually involves multiple stages:

    1. Placing the implant into the jawbone
    2. Healing period for the implant to fuse with the bone
    3. Attaching a connector (abutment)
    4. Fixing a dental crown on top

    Although the process takes time, the results are long-lasting and natural-looking.

    Benefits of Dental Implants

    • Look and feel like natural teeth
    • Improve chewing and speech
    • Prevent bone loss in the jaw
    • Do not affect nearby teeth
    • Long-lasting with proper care

    These benefits make implants a preferred choice for many patients.

    Caring for Dental Implants

    Dental implants require the same care as natural teeth:

    • Brush and floss daily
    • Avoid chewing very hard foods
    • Visit your dentist for regular check-ups

    Good maintenance helps implants last for many years.

    Braces vs Aligners – Which Is Better for You?

    Braces vs Aligners – Which Is Better for You?

    If you’re thinking about straightening your teeth, you’ve probably come across two popular options: braces and clear aligners. Both are effective orthodontic treatments, but they work in different ways and suit different lifestyles.

    Understanding the differences can help you choose the right option for your dental needs.

    What Are Dental Braces?

    Dental braces use metal or ceramic brackets attached to the teeth and connected with wires. Over time, gentle pressure moves the teeth into proper alignment.

    Braces are commonly used for children and teenagers, but many adults also choose them for complex alignment issues.

    What Are Clear Aligners?

    Clear aligners are transparent, removable trays that gradually straighten teeth. Each set is worn for a specific period before moving to the next one.

    Aligners are popular among adults because they are less noticeable and easy to remove during meals.

    Key Differences Between Braces and Aligners

    Appearance

    Braces are visible, while aligners are nearly invisible.

    Comfort

    Aligners are generally more comfortable as they don’t have wires or brackets that can irritate the mouth.

    Removability

    Braces are fixed, whereas aligners can be removed while eating or brushing.

    Effectiveness

    Braces are more suitable for severe or complex dental issues. Aligners work best for mild to moderate alignment problems.

    Discipline Required

    Aligners must be worn consistently for best results. Braces work continuously without relying on patient compliance.

    Which Option Is Better for You?

    You may prefer braces if:

    • You have complex alignment or bite issues
    • You don’t want the responsibility of removing and wearing trays

    You may prefer aligners if:

    • You want a discreet teeth-straightening option
    • You can wear them consistently as advised
    • You prefer easier oral hygiene during treatment

    A dentist or orthodontist can assess your teeth and recommend the most suitable option.

    Root Canal Treatment – Procedure, Pain & Cost Explained

    Root Canal Treatment – Procedure, Pain & Cost Explained

    Severe tooth pain can make everyday activities difficult. One of the most common treatments recommended for intense tooth pain or infection is root canal treatment. Despite common fears, modern root canal procedures are safe, effective, and mostly painless.

    Here’s everything you need to know before opting for a root canal treatment.

    What Is Root Canal Treatment?

    A root canal treatment is performed when the soft tissue inside the tooth, called pulp, becomes infected or damaged due to deep decay, cracks, or injury.

    The goal of the treatment is to remove the infection, save the natural tooth, and prevent further complications.

    When Do You Need a Root Canal?

    You may need a root canal treatment if you experience:

    • Persistent tooth pain
    • Sensitivity to hot or cold
    • Swollen or bleeding gums near a tooth
    • Darkening of a tooth
    • Pain while chewing

    Ignoring these symptoms can lead to abscess formation and tooth loss.

    Root Canal Procedure Explained

    The root canal procedure is usually completed in one or two visits:

    1. The dentist numbs the area using local anesthesia.
    2. The infected pulp is removed from inside the tooth.
    3. The root canal is cleaned and disinfected.
    4. The canal is sealed to prevent reinfection.
    5. A crown may be placed to restore strength and function.

    The procedure helps eliminate pain rather than cause it.

    Is Root Canal Treatment Painful?

    This is one of the most common concerns. With modern dental techniques and anesthesia, root canal treatment is mostly painless.

    You may feel mild discomfort or sensitivity for a few days after the procedure, which usually subsides with proper care.

    Recovery and Aftercare

    After a root canal:

    • Avoid chewing hard foods on the treated tooth for a few days
    • Maintain good oral hygiene
    • Follow the dentist’s instructions
    • Visit for follow-up if advised

    Most people return to normal activities within a short time.

    What About the Cost?

    The cost of root canal treatment depends on factors like:

    • Tooth location
    • Severity of infection
    • Number of canals involved
    • Additional restoration like crowns

    Types of Dental Treatments You Should Know About

    Types of Dental Treatments You Should Know About

    Visiting a dentist is not just about fixing tooth pain. Modern dentistry offers a wide range of treatments that help maintain oral health, improve appearance, and prevent future problems. Knowing the different types of dental treatments can help you make informed decisions and seek timely care.

    Below are the most common dental treatments you should be aware of.

    1. Teeth Cleaning and Scaling

    Teeth cleaning, also called scaling, is one of the most basic and important dental treatments. It removes plaque, tartar, and stains that regular brushing cannot eliminate.

    This treatment helps prevent cavities, gum disease, and bad breath. Dentists usually recommend professional cleaning every six months.

    2. Dental Fillings

    Dental fillings are used to treat cavities caused by tooth decay. The decayed portion of the tooth is removed and filled with materials like composite resin or amalgam.

    Fillings restore the tooth’s shape and function and prevent further decay.

    3. Root Canal Treatment

    When tooth decay reaches the inner pulp of the tooth, a root canal treatment is required. During this procedure, the infected pulp is removed, the canal is cleaned, and it is sealed.

    Root canal treatment helps save the natural tooth and relieves severe tooth pain.

    4. Dental Braces and Aligners

    Braces and aligners are orthodontic treatments used to straighten crooked teeth and correct bite issues.

    Traditional braces use metal brackets and wires, while clear aligners are removable and less noticeable. Both options improve oral health and appearance over time.

    5. Dental Implants

    Dental implants are a permanent solution for missing teeth. An artificial tooth root is placed into the jawbone, and a crown is fixed on top.

    Implants look and function like natural teeth and help maintain jawbone strength.

    6. Cosmetic Dentistry

    Cosmetic dentistry focuses on improving the appearance of teeth and smile. Common cosmetic treatments include teeth whitening, veneers, and smile makeovers.

    These treatments are popular among people looking to boost confidence and improve their smile.

    What Counts as a Dental Emergency?

    Sudden tooth pain, swelling, or a broken tooth can turn into a serious problem if not treated quickly. This is why searches for emergency dentist near me and urgent dental care near me are increasing rapidly across India. When pain strikes, people don’t want research-they want immediate help nearby.

    Dental emergencies are time-sensitive, and fast local access can prevent complications.

    Many patients are unsure whether their situation is an emergency. In general, urgent dental care is needed when there is:

    • Severe or persistent tooth pain
    • Swelling in the gums or face
    • Bleeding that does not stop
    • Broken, cracked, or knocked-out teeth
    • Signs of infection such as pus or fever

    In these cases, waiting can make treatment more complex and painful.

    What to Do While Looking for an Emergency Dentist

    While searching for urgent care:

    • Rinse mouth with warm salt water
    • Avoid placing painkillers directly on gums
    • Use a cold compress for swelling
    • Contact a nearby clinic immediately

    Quick action can prevent infection from spreading and reduce long-term damage.
